What are Design Sprints?
Design sprints are a structured framework for collaboration and problem-solving in the design process. They were popularized by Google Ventures and have since been adopted by numerous design teams and agencies worldwide. A design sprint typically lasts for one to two weeks and involves cross-functional teams working together intensively to define and solve design challenges.
The Benefits of Design Sprints
Design sprints offer several benefits to both designers and clients. Here are some of the key advantages:
1. Accelerated Design Process
Design sprints compress the design process into a short timeframe, allowing teams to quickly ideate, prototype, and test solutions. This accelerated timeline helps in meeting tight deadlines and launching products or campaigns faster.
2. Enhanced Collaboration
Design sprints bring together designers, developers, marketers, and other stakeholders who collaborate closely throughout the sprint. This cross-functional collaboration fosters better communication, understanding, and alignment among team members.
3. Iterative Design and Feedback
Design sprints encourage iterative design by rapidly prototyping and testing ideas. This approach allows for quick feedback from users and stakeholders, enabling teams to refine and improve their designs based on real-world insights.
4. Reduced Risk
By validating ideas early in the design process, design sprints help mitigate the risk of developing products or campaigns that do not resonate with the target audience. This early validation saves time, resources, and effort in the long run.
